Lungless salamanders (4.1 g) were exercised on a treadmill enclosed in a Plexiglas respirometer at a range of speeds (0.05-0.24 km/h). O2 consumption (VO2) was determined continuously by open-flow respirometry. At the onset of exercise VO2 increased to a "steady state" in approximately 2-5 min. Microtubules are long, proteinaceous filaments that perform structural functions in eukaryotic cells by defining cellular shape and serving as tracks for intracellular motor proteins. We report the first accurate measurements of the flexural rigidity of microtubules. Our objectives were to study the loss of heat from ischemic brain and to devise a method of maintaining brain temperature. Reversible forebrain ischemia was induced by carotid clamping and exsanguination in 30 anesthetized and artificially ventilated rats.
